Be Holy

As believers, we need to understand that God is holy, righteous and just. He hates sins and every kind of evil. In his Kingdom, which we call the Third Heaven, there is no sin and no evil for they cannot exist in his presence.

The angels who serve him are holy and those who died and went to Heaven were made holy. Without holiness, no one can come near to God. This includes both angels and men.

When Satan and a third of the angels rebelled against God, they were banished from the Third Heaven. They had become sinful and unholy. They were not allowed to enter the Kingdom of God forever and had to occupy the lower heavens.

Likewise, Adam and Eve were also banished from God’s presence when they sinned in the garden of Eden. Both of them and their descendants could no longer come near to God and see him face-to-face.

God however loves mankind. He longs for that intimate fellowship with men that was lost in the garden of Eden. But for that to happen, sinful men must be made holy again. This however requires that their sins must first be forgiven and taken away.

So he sent Jesus Christ, his only Son, to the world to die as a man to atone for their sins. God also sent his Spirit (Holy Spirit) into the heart of believers to lead them in the way of holiness and righteousness.

This therefore is how God makes sinful men holy again. First, by making them holy through Jesus’ blood by faith. Then by enabling and calling them to live a holy life.

As believers, God has already made us holy through Jesus Christ. Now it is our turn to keep ourselves that way!

The Bible reveals further that our bodies are now the Temple of the Holy Spirit. That means God’s holy presence is now inside us. We are therefore not to defile ourselves with what is sinful. We are to forsake our sins and keep ourselves holy.

If we do sin, let us be quick to repent and turn away from evil. God is just and faithful to forgive us and to cleanse us from all unrighteousness. But if anyone will not repent and continue to sin wilfully, the Bible warns that he will be judged and burned with fire in the end.

Therefore let us remember that without holiness, no one will see God. We must not forget why angels and men were banished from God’s presence in the first place. But as obedient children, let us not conform to evil desires but to be holy in all we do. For God said: “Be holy, because I am holy.”
